Missing `configuration.accounts` property in Pleroma servers
Environment
- Pleroma version (could be found in the "Version" tab of settings in Pleroma-FE): "2.7.2 (compatible; Pleroma 2.6.51-650-g 0b9bc4a0-develop)" (at least, but see below)
Bug description
Some Pleroma servers are not returning a configuration.accounts
property at /api/v2/instance
. This is a non-nullable non-optional property, so it should be present.
Affected servers (incomplete): activitypub.agates.io, apontaeclica.com, bassam.social, bearvideo.win, c.wtf, clew.lol, fediverse.spearman.xyz, foygl.com, gleasonator.com, hidamari.apartments, iddqd.social, idolheaven.org, jacksonhomestead.me, killyour.dad, leafposter.club, lm.kazv.moe, neenster.org, orwell.fun, p.sugar-free-jazz.com, parcero.bond, pl.eragon.re, pl.fediverse.pl, pl.kotobank.ch, pleroma.dark-alexandr.net, pleroma.pibvt.net, pleroma.woodynet.net, rabbithou.se, rebased.social, rebased.taihou.website, redsnake.io, seal.cafe, shinkai.party, shitposting.on.incorrigible.moe, social.dansonline.space, social.linuxine.net, social.luizpicolo.com.br, social.protectors.moe, social.rucksfuchs.de, social.teci.world, socialgoblins.club, sosial.agdersam.no, svltan.at, twhtv.club, updog.no, vnil.de, vocalfry.social